Position Title: Manager, Billing/Credit Ops & Systems
Job ID: 107553
Location: Las Vegas, NV
Posting Close Date: 05/20/2025
Facility: Pearson Building
Department: Billing - NVE South
Full/Part Time: Full-Time
Regular/Temporary: Regular
Travel Percentage: <= 25%
Description:
Basic Purpose
Provides direction and leadership in the development and support of the company’s interval data system and its related systems. In collaboration with Information Technology & Telecommunications(IT&T), creates the long-term strategy and planning of entire system, as well as short-term planning, development, implementation and maintenance of company’s customer information and meter data management systems. Manages all processes that impact company revenue, reserve rates, write-offs, and credit and collection policies. Interacts with regulators and auditors on a regular basis. Assures compliance with corporate policies and procedures, legal and regulatory requirements and generally accepted business practices.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
Develops short-term technical business plans for the meter data management system and supports the development of long-term plans, ensuring that capacity planning and research & development are addressed as necessary
Partners with business units to understand business requirements and translates the plans to technical possibilities.
Develops and tracks action/implementation plans
Organizes the department consistently with tactical and strategic objectives
Adjusts staff assignments when implementing new technologies and/or changing business requirements.
Coordinates with the project management office to ensure that all major projects are appropriately monitored and costs are controlled.
Oversees and manages the Billing, Credit, and Final Bills functions:
Ensures timely and accurate processes of bills, customer payments, collections, account write-offs and company reserve rates.
Ensures bills comply with all regulatory requirements; completes rate changes as required; processes payment files timely.
Accountable for credit policies for all customers; monitors monthly aging reports; improves processes to reduce fraudulent activity on disconnected customers; monitors active arrears data; develops payment options.
Supervises day-to-day activity related to inactive account receivables and interacts with other departments to develop reserve rates.
Responsible for accuracy of meter data management system.
Primary relationship manager and liaison between IT&T and customer service leadership. Works with peer leaders, directors, and vice presidents to establish direction, prioritize projects and develop strategy for customer service related technologies.
In conjunction with IT&T leadership, provides leadership in the development and implementation of the strategic and operating plan for customer information systems by investigating current technology and making recommendations to management for enhancements and process improvements.
Ensures that all necessary controls are in place and are appropriately updated and tracked, specifically areas that fall within the Sarbanes-Oxley required compliance areas. Designs, implements and monitors internal controls to ensure system changes and the processes for completing them have data integrity. Enforces and manages adherence to change management procedures and processes for all changes introduced into the customer information system and the meter data management system.
Verifies that plans are executed in accordance with good project management practices.
Coordinates with IT&T leadership and internal customers to develop metrics and service level agreements and manages toward exceeding expectations. Monitors and frequently communicates results.
Directs personnel activities of staff (i.e. hires, trains, rewards, disciplines, motivates, etc.).
Negotiates and administers vendor contracts for customer information systems services.
Continually evaluates current business processes and seeks to improve internal operations wherever possible.
Encourages staff to seek out business processes where technology solutions will improve business operations.
Ensures all compliance aspects of position are known and followed; understands and complies with all policies, codes and regulations applicable to position and company.
Monitors and enforces all compliance requirements for area of responsibility.
Performs related duties as assigned.
Essential Education, Skills, and Environment
Education and Work Experience
Bachelor’s degree in the area of specialty from an accredited school and 6 or more years of related experience with one year of project management or leadership experience and two years of technical, hands-on, business problem analysis and resolution experience.
Candidates that do not possess a bachelor’s degree must have 10 or more years of related experience with one year of project management or leadership experience and two years of technical, hands-on, business problem analysis and resolution experience.
Specialized Knowledge and Skills
Demonstrated leadership and negotiation skills. Ability to implement and manage large system implementations. Working knowledge of existing Banner Customer Information System and Meter Data Management Systems. In-depth knowledge of interval data submittal process for the Energy Imbalance Market. Ability to prioritize, accomplish multiple priorities and make effective decisions in an ever-changing, dynamic, business environment. Interpersonal skills that enable communication with employees at all levels within the organization.
Equipment and Applications
PCs, word processing, spreadsheet and database software.
Work Environment and Physical Demands
General office environment. No special physical demands required
Annual Salary: $119,400 (Min) to $140,400 (Mid); Up to 15% Short Term Incentive Plan target opportunity at the discretion of the company. This is a non-represented position.
